Transaction 33d39aafc7b3dbf10dcb205eadf9a80ff95aacab8213446e42da3f5264cdb8de

1 Input
2 Outputs
  • 33d39aafc7b3dbf10dcb205eadf9a80ff95aacab8213446e42da3f5264cdb8de:0
  • value  1516526
    address  bc1qh5l2ua7zzzdhlr7878s4yh9g9afcrr7vtdljxz
  • 33d39aafc7b3dbf10dcb205eadf9a80ff95aacab8213446e42da3f5264cdb8de:1
  • value  51789503
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X